Output 85cdf59bc2d6778b67e2e6b512ae0d4ba2c401181feb4738fcf7a1b08c5a2e81:0

value
1740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ac39f59c3b687cbd6ecd0841600e58e6748e513 OP_EQUAL
address
348XqcpX34MsPrfH68opUE8Hrg2rhZGiEe
transaction
85cdf59bc2d6778b67e2e6b512ae0d4ba2c401181feb4738fcf7a1b08c5a2e81